Transcript
What skills are most important for a job like yours?
As a consultant, there are at least three important skills. The first is communication skills, because consultants usually do client-facing projects. This means consultants should communicate often with clients, explaining clearly about problems and how they solve them.
Communication skills are important. It's not only about verbal communication but also non-verbal. Everything related to communication is important because consultants usually present results periodically to the client, whether in informal written reports or direct presentations.
Another skill important for a consultant is teamwork. As consultants, we usually don't work alone. We are often assigned to projects with three to four other team members. Teamwork is really important because when solving client problems, we usually need discussions and brainstorming within the team.
The last skill I thought important is adaptability. Working in a consulting firm is not very predictable. Sometimes there are many sudden changes, and client expectations are always changing. To adapt to new situations very quickly is something a consultant should have to create quality results.
